DEUTZ is one of the world’s leading manufacturers of innovative drive systems. Its core competences are the development, production, distribution and servicing of diesel, gas and electric drivetrains for professional applications that is used in construction equipment, agricultural machinery, material handling equipment, stationary equipment, commercial vehicles, rail vehicles and other applications.
The Financial Analyst is responsible for financial reporting, analysis, and business performance insights across the organization. This role analyzes financial and operational data, identifies trends and opportunities, and provides recommendations to support continuous business improvement and decision-making. The position regularly interacts with mid- and upper-level management, requiring strong analytical, communication, and interpersonal skills, both written and verbal.
